The Impact of a Poor Driving Record on Car Insurance
First, let's discuss why having a poor driving record can affect your car insurance rates.Insurance companies
use your driving record as one of the main factors in determining your risk as a driver.If you have a history of accidents, traffic violations, or DUIs, it signals to the insurance company that you are a high-risk driver. As a result, they may charge you higher premiums to offset the potential cost of insuring you. In Charlottesville, VA, the average cost of car insurance for someone with a clean driving record is around $1,200 per year. However, if you have a poor driving record, that cost can increase significantly. In some cases, it can even double or triple.

Tips for Lowering Your Car Insurance Rates with a Poor Driving Record
While getting car insurance with a poor driving record may be more challenging, there are still ways to lower your rates. Here are some tips:- Improve Your Driving Record: The best way to lower your car insurance rates is to improve your driving record. Avoid getting any more tickets or accidents and maintain a clean driving record for at least three years. This will show the insurance company that you are becoming a less risky driver and may result in lower rates.
- Take a Defensive Driving Course: Some insurance companies offer discounts to drivers who take a defensive driving course.
This course can help you improve your driving skills and show the insurance company that you are committed to being a safe driver.
- Consider a Different Car: The type of car you drive can also impact your insurance rates. If you have a high-performance or luxury vehicle, your rates may be higher. Consider switching to a more affordable car that is less expensive to insure.
- Bundle Your Insurance Policies: Many insurance companies offer discounts to customers who bundle their car insurance with other policies, such as home or renters insurance. Consider bundling your policies to save money on your car insurance.
